What they do

A Medical Records or Health Information Technician works with data from medical records to process, maintain, compile, analyze and report patient information for health requirements and standards in a manner consistent with the healthcare industry's numerical coding system and reporting standards

King Dr. San Antonio, Texas, 78203 United States Requisition #: req14027 Outside working hours if other than M-F 8: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m.: Evenings and weekends may be required Job Summary and Description Teaching faculty are professional educators who have the primary responsibility of fulfilling the District mission of providing a quality education for all students attending the colleges. Categories include full-time, temporary with benefits, and temporary without benefits. Faculty members are responsible to a department/program chairperson; The relationship of the faculty member to the student is one of leader, teacher, advisor, and facilitator of learning. Faculty members will uphold the mission and values of the colleges' and foster effective working relationships with students and colleagues.
Qualifications Minimum Education and Experience:
Hold a Bachelors degree in Medical Records Administration, Health Information Management, Medical Record Science or Administration with current licensure, certification, or registration; OR hold a minimum of an Associates degree; PLUS, three years documentation of demonstrated work experience in the teaching field.
Licenses and Certifications:
Hold a current certification in Registered Health Information Technician (RHIT) or Registered Health Information Administrator (RHIA).
